What is the cheapest month to fly from Santa Ana to Liberia?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Santa Ana to Liberia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Santa Ana to Liberia is October, where tickets cost $382 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, where the average cost of tickets is $747 and $725 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Santa Ana to Liberia?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Santa Ana to Liberia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Santa Ana to Liberia, you should book around 1 day before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 71 days before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from John Wayne (Santa Ana) to Liberia?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Liberia with an airline and back to John Wayne (Santa Ana) with another airline. Booking your flights between John Wayne (Santa Ana) and LIR can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
